My tools:

  • Haxe with Physaxe or AS3 with Flixel, depending on the idea
  • DAME for tilemap editing, should I need it
  • Photoshop CS3 for whatever I can pass off as art
  • GarageBand (or Famitracker if I’m feeling generous with my time budget) for music
  • bfxr for sound
